Solution for x+x*x=48 equation:



x+x*x=48
We move all terms to the left:
x+x*x-(48)=0
Wy multiply elements
x^2+x-48=0
a = 1; b = 1; c = -48;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= 12-4·1·(-48)
Δ = 193
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(1)-\sqrt{193}}{2*1}=\frac{-1-\sqrt{193}}{2} $
$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(1)+\sqrt{193}}{2*1}=\frac{-1+\sqrt{193}}{2} $
